解决python调用 ffmpeg时 ‘ffmpeg‘ 不是内部或外部命令,也不是可运行的程序,ffmpeg乱码

  • Post author:
  • Post category:python


解决python调用 ffmpeg时 ‘ffmpeg‘ 不是内部或外部命令,也不是可运行的程序

streamlink’ �����ڲ����ⲿ���Ҳ���ǿ����еij���

���������ļ���

花了我三四个小时,百度,谷歌,自己猜问题

解决办法:

下面的 Default encoding for properties files设置为GBK,OK了

我的问题是cmd命令执行的exe文件没有加到环境变量,乱码完全看不到报错信息

我的cmd编码是936,也就是GBK模式

可能是cmd编码与pycharm需要一致的原因


文章知识点与官方知识档案匹配,可进一步学习相关知识

————————————————

版权声明:本文为CSDN博主「qq_20849423」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。

原文链接:https://blog.csdn.net/qq_20849423/article/details/83629075

解决 python 调用 ffmpeg时 ‘ffmpeg’ 不是内部或外部命令,也不是可运行的程序

在windows系统下, 我们使用windows下,使用ffmpeg库调用FFmpeg工具来提取视频的图片/读取视频信息

import ffmpeg

1

我们可能会遇到以下问题

‘ffmpeg’ 不是内部或外部命令,也不是可运行的程序

1

这原因是什么呢?

python 的ffmpeg 是使用subprocess.Popen()函数来调用命令行,然后得到返回的数据。就相当于python 在你系统的cmd里面输入 ffmpeg xxx xxx xxx xxx

然后系统给你报错 ‘ffmpeg’ 不是内部或外部命令,也不是可运行的程序

那么有两种原因:

没安装 ffmpeg

那么请参考安装 ffmpeg

没加入环境变量

请参考:https://blog.csdn.net/tang_chuanlin/article/details/103749351

但是最快的方法就是, 当你下载好 ffmpeg

然后解压, 记下bin的路径

E://anaconda//ffmpeg-4.3.1//bin//

1

然后修改ffmpeg的那块代码

《你的python包路径 》/site-packages/ffmpeg/_probe.py

直接加上ffmpeg的路径即可

《你的python包路径 》/site-packages/ffmpeg/_run.py

直接加上ffmpeg的路径即可


B站:阿里武

关注

1


6

6


专栏目录

26岁,转行Python,是这辈子最成功的一件事……

a379749的博客

5667

我是26岁转行学Python的。说实在,转行就是奔着挣钱去的。希望我的经历可以给想转行的朋友带来一点启发和借鉴。 先简单介绍下个人背景,三流大学毕业,物流专业,学习能力一般,没啥特别技能,反正就很普通的一个人!工作五年存款7000,感觉生活无望,就直接决定转行。 我决定转行IT行业理由很简单,体面行业,不用体力劳动,办公环境大多不错,行业回报率高,做哪一行都不轻松,但是IT回报率可能更高。而且现今互联网趋势明显,IT人才是通用人才,走到哪都不怕找不到工作。 我是完全小白,没基础,所以学习过程还是非常痛苦的

python 视频播放器 ffmpeg_Python3 ffmpeg视频转换工具使用方法解析

weixin_39973410的博客

155

windows版本下需要先安装ffmpeg工具:可以下载了static版本(是个zip压缩包),解压到指定目录,去配置环境变量,比如d:\ffmpeg\bin,这样bin下面的ffmpeg.exe就可以在命令行中使用了,可以用ffmpeg -version测试一下:2:安装ffmpeg的python扩展,该扩展可以让你直接在python脚本中直接调用,而不需要单独运行命令: pip install…

评论6


白面momo(Mario Wang)

2022.04.18

_probe找不到

白面momo(Mario Wang)

2022.04.18

安装ffmpeg链接打不开

mhack5200

2021.11.15

1

环境变量加了,在cmd里面可以用ffmpeg,python上os.system(“ffmpeg -i —-“)就不行

lingduxingxi

回复

Ryan_蛤蟆

2022.04.13

我的也是一样,怎么解决啊?

查看全部 3 条回复

————————————————

版权声明:本文为CSDN博主「B站:阿里武」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。

原文链接:https://blog.csdn.net/qq874455953/article/details/109560175